About Fabian Köhler

Fabian Köhler is a scholar working on Aging, Atomic and Molecular Physics, and Optics and Immunology, having authored 44 papers that have together received 1.6k indexed citations. Recurring topics across this work include Photonic and Optical Devices (14 papers), Semiconductor Lasers and Optical Devices (14 papers) and Semiconductor Quantum Structures and Devices (9 papers). The work is most often cited by research in Genetics (393 citations), Immunology (451 citations) and Pathology and Forensic Medicine (275 citations). Fabian Köhler has collaborated with scholars based in Germany, United Kingdom and Netherlands. Frequent co-authors include Hassan Jumaa, Thomas Wossning, Hendrik Dietz, Hedda Wardemann, M. Ortsiefer, R. Shau, Michael Bach, Sonja Meixlsperger, G. Böhm and Maike Buchner. Their work appears in journals such as Nature, Journal of the American Chemical Society and Physical Review Letters.
